Javier De Andrés is a Senior Site Reliability Engineer with 12 years building resilient cloud-native and Big Data platforms across Europe, currently shaping blockchain infrastructure and automation at cLabs. He blends telecommunications engineering fundamentals with hands-on DevOps and platform architecture experience—designing PaaS solutions, Kubernetes/containers, Mesos, Docker, and infrastructure-as-code using Terraform, Ansible and HashiCorp tools. Javier has led DevOps teams at organizations like Keyko, Ocean Protocol and Stratio, and mentored cloud and DevOps students for MIT Professional Education, reflecting both technical leadership and pedagogy. He contributes to the Celo blockchain core in Go, improving backend performance, metrics and websocket resiliency, showing a practical focus on observability and production hardening. Comfortable across NoSQL, Spark, Kafka and the Hadoop ecosystem, he combines systems thinking with scripting and automation to operationalize complex distributed systems. Based in Madrid, he brings a pragmatic mix of research-informed methods and production-grade execution that surfaces in both architecture and day-to-day reliability work.

celo-org/celo-blockchain

Dec 2019 - Mar 2022

Official repository for the golang Celo Blockchain
Role in this project:
userBack-end Developer
Contributions:2 releases, 16 reviews, 34 commits in 2 years 3 months
Contributions summary:Javier contributed to the Celo blockchain project by modifying core backend functionalities. They refactored and renamed methods related to web3 Istanbul proxy, added new metrics for transaction and gas usage, and added new flags for HTTP timeouts, indicating involvement in performance and monitoring improvements. Further contributions include changing proxy and proxied checks and relaxing websocket connection header checks.
